Special to ESPN.com Wednesday, January 15, 2003 Mirror, mirror on the wall, who's the furthest of them all? The Dallas Mavericks, in the standings. They own the best record in the league with a six-game winning streak, nine victories in the past 10 games and the cushion of an eight-game lead over San Antonio in the Midwest Division. The Sacramento Kings, in reality. The Pacific Division leaders have proved it when it matters, the playoffs. This regular season hasn't exactly been a disappointment, either. Two teams, one look.
